Routes to the top

Indian Venster

    • Start: Tafelberg Road
    • End: Table Mountain Summit
    • Length: 4 km
    • Duration: 3-4 hours
    • Dog Friendly: No
    • Total Climb:

Moderate to Strenuous

Platteklip Gorge

    • Start: Tafelberg Road
    • End: Table Mountain Summit
    • Length: 3 km
    • Duration: 2-3 hours
    • Dog Friendly: No
    • Total Climb :

Moderate to Strenuous

Skeleton Gorge

    • Start: Kirstenbosch  Gardens
    • End: Table Mountain Summit
    • Length: 6 km
    • Duration: 4-5 hours
    • Dog Friendly: No
    • Total Climb:

Moderate to Strenuous

Kasteelpoort

    • Start: Pipe Track, Camps Bay
    • End: Table Mountain Summit
    • Length: 7 km
    • Duration: 4-5 hours
    • Dog Friendly: No
    • Total Climb:

 Moderate to Strenuous

Table Mountain by Cable Car

Looking for a breathtaking adventure that combines innovation, history, and unparalleled views. Try the Cable Car!  This iconic cable car ride offers you the chance to scale one of the New7Wonders of Nature in a mere five minutes, while you revel in a 360-degree panorama of Cape Town’s unparalleled beauty.

Once you reach the summit, be prepared to be enchanted by the stunning vistas of Table Bay, Robben Island, and the vibrant city below. Between the free guided tours, delightful meal options, and a Wi-Fi lounge situated 1,067 metres above sea level, your mountain-top experience promises to be as unforgettable as the journey there.
